Gulf War DBQ: Winning Your Disability Claim

The Gulf War, while seemingly concluded decades ago, continues to impact the lives of many veterans. Many suffer from illnesses with no readily apparent cause, leading to challenges in obtaining disability benefits. Navigating the Department of Veterans Affairs (VA) system can be a daunting task, especially when dealing with complex conditions linked to Gulf War illnesses. This article will provide guidance on successfully tackling your Gulf War disability claim, focusing on the crucial role of the Disability Benefits Questionnaire (DBQ).

Understanding the DBQ's Importance

The DBQ is a critical component of your disability claim. It's a standardized form used by VA medical professionals to provide a detailed assessment of your health condition. A well-completed DBQ, which accurately reflects your symptoms and limitations, significantly increases your chances of a favorable outcome. It's not just about filling out the forms; it's about presenting a compelling narrative of your experience.

Key Elements of a Strong DBQ:

  • Comprehensive Symptom Description: Don't underestimate the power of detailed descriptions. Include specific symptoms, their frequency, severity, and how they impact your daily life. The more detail you provide, the clearer the picture for the VA examiner. Mention specific dates if possible, tying symptoms to your time in the Gulf War.

  • Supporting Evidence: Your DBQ should be supported by additional evidence. This could include:

    • Medical records: Gather all relevant medical records, both from your time in service and post-service. This includes doctor's notes, lab results, and hospital records.
    • Lay statements: Statements from family, friends, and colleagues who can attest to your symptoms and limitations can be invaluable.
    • Service treatment records: These records, if available, can establish a connection between your current condition and your time in the Gulf War.
  • Functional Impact: Explain how your symptoms affect your daily activities. Be specific about the limitations you face – are you unable to work, care for yourself, or engage in hobbies? Quantify your limitations whenever possible. For example, instead of saying "I have difficulty sleeping," say "I wake up at least five times a night and struggle to return to sleep, resulting in chronic fatigue that prevents me from working more than four hours a day."

  • Consistency: Ensure consistency between your DBQ, supporting medical evidence, and your personal statement. Discrepancies can weaken your claim.

Strategizing for Success: Beyond the DBQ

While the DBQ is crucial, it's only one piece of the puzzle. A successful claim often depends on a broader strategy:

Seeking Expert Medical Help:

Consider seeking a medical professional specializing in Gulf War illnesses. These doctors understand the unique challenges associated with these conditions and can effectively document your symptoms in a way that resonates with the VA. They can also help fill out your DBQ accurately and thoroughly.

Working with a Veteran's Service Organization (VSO):

VSOs like the Veterans of Foreign Wars (VFW), the American Legion, and Disabled American Veterans (DAV) offer valuable assistance with navigating the VA claims process. They can provide guidance, help with paperwork, and represent you before the VA.

Appealing if Necessary:

If your initial claim is denied, don't give up. The VA appeals process can be complex, but with persistence and the right support, you can still succeed. An experienced VSO or attorney can guide you through this process.
